About Tax Law in Denizli, Turkey

Tax law in Denizli, Turkey, operates under the broader framework of the Turkish tax system, which is governed primarily by national legislation but applied regionally by local tax offices. As a rapidly developing industrial and commercial center, Denizli's taxpayers include a diverse mixture of individuals, small businesses, and large companies. Tax regulations cover areas such as income tax, corporate tax, value-added tax (VAT), property tax, and special consumption taxes. Compliance is overseen by the local branches of the Turkish Revenue Administration and Denizli's municipal authorities.

Local Laws Overview

Denizli is subject to Turkish national tax law, which is regulated by statutes such as the Income Tax Law, Corporate Tax Law, and VAT Law. Key aspects include:

  • Personal and Corporate Income Tax: Residents and companies are taxed on worldwide income, while non-residents are taxed only on Turkey-sourced income.
  • Value Added Tax (VAT): Most goods and services are subject to VAT, with rates and exemptions defined nationally.
  • Property and Municipal Taxes: Property owners in Denizli are subject to annual property taxes and possible environmental or usage taxes at the local level.
  • Tax Returns and Deadlines: There are specific filing deadlines throughout the year for individuals and businesses, which are strictly enforced.
  • Enforcement and Penalties: Failure to comply with obligations may result in audits, fines, or legal actions.
  • Tax Dispute Resolution: Taxpayers have the right to contest assessments and challenge decisions through administrative appeals or the tax courts.

Local nuances, such as regional incentives for certain industries or changes in municipal taxes, may also be relevant and should be clarified with local experts.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of taxes are most common in Denizli?

The most common taxes are income tax (for individuals), corporate tax (for companies), VAT (for goods and services), property tax, and special consumption taxes.

How do I determine my tax residence status in Turkey?

Individuals residing in Turkey for more than six months in a calendar year are generally considered tax residents and are taxed on their worldwide income.

When are tax returns due in Denizli?

Deadlines vary: personal income tax returns are typically due in March, while corporate tax filings are due in April. VAT and other periodic taxes may have monthly or quarterly deadlines.

Can I appeal a tax assessment or penalty?

Yes, taxpayers have the right to submit administrative appeals to the relevant tax office and, if necessary, take the dispute to the tax courts.

What documents should I keep for tax purposes?

Keep all invoices, receipts, payroll records, contracts, and prior tax filings for at least five years in case of audits or verification by authorities.

Are there any local tax incentives in Denizli?

Certain sectors, such as textiles and exports, may benefit from national and regional incentives or reduced rates. It is advisable to consult local authorities or a lawyer for specifics.

What are the penalties for late tax payments?

Late payments may incur fines, interest charges, and in severe cases, enforcement measures such as asset freezes. Prompt action is recommended to avoid escalating penalties.

How are foreign-sourced incomes taxed for residents?

Residents must declare and pay tax on worldwide income, including income generated from foreign sources, subject to double tax treaties to prevent double taxation.

What should foreign investors know about tax in Denizli?

Foreign investors are subject to the same taxes as locals, but may benefit from investment incentives. Understanding relevant treaties, incentives, and administrative requirements is key.

Additional Resources

There are several resources and institutions able to assist those seeking tax information or legal advice in Denizli:

  • Denizli Tax Office (Denizli Vergi Dairesi Başkanlığı): The local body responsible for tax administration and guidance.
  • Ministry of Treasury and Finance - Revenue Administration (Gelir İdaresi Başkanlığı): Provides national and local tax regulations, forms, and e-services.
  • Professional Bar Associations: The Denizli Bar Association can help in locating qualified tax lawyers.
  • Certified Public Accountants (SMMM): Licensed accountants can assist with filings and bookkeeping.
  • TURMOB: The Union of Chambers of Certified Public Accountants of Turkey, for additional guidance and resources.
